@bullitthead7853Ай бұрын
Oil is rarely filled in the same location as the dipstick/dipstick tube. Most engines have a separate oil fill and dipstick. So, this engine retains the oil fill but eliminates the dipstick. There are some engines that do have a dipstick attached to the oil fill cap though, so the oil is installed and checked at the same place.

@danieljones3683Ай бұрын
Yeah if it's like the 3.0 in the Jeep Wagoneer the first or second time you change the oil the oil level sensor will fail and say your engine is overfilled or too low and you have no way to verify it. I am a rental car fleet technician this has been a major issue. Also it's so common the sensor is always backordered.
